全网最全OpenClaw(龙虾)插件开发documentation
2026-03-19 0引言
全网最全OpenClaw(龙虾)插件开发documentation 是指面向开发者、技术型跨境卖家及SaaS服务商,用于集成与调用 OpenClaw(一款面向跨境电商数据采集与自动化运营的开源/半开源工具,社区常称“龙虾”)所必需的官方或社区整理的开发文档集合。其中,OpenClaw 是一个基于浏览器自动化(如 Playwright/Puppeteer)构建的数据抓取与流程编排工具;插件开发 指通过其 SDK、API 或插件框架扩展功能(如对接 ERP、自动上架、价格监控、评论采集等)。

主体
它能解决哪些问题
- 场景化痛点→对应价值:平台接口限频/无开放API → 利用插件模拟真实用户行为,绕过限制采集竞品价格、库存、Review等非结构化数据;
- 场景化痛点→对应价值:多平台运营需重复配置脚本 → 插件化封装通用逻辑(如Shopee商品页解析器),一次开发、多店复用;
- 场景化痛点→对应价值:ERP/选品工具缺乏实时数据源 → 通过自研插件将OpenClaw采集流接入内部系统,实现分钟级数据同步。
怎么用/怎么开通/怎么选择
OpenClaw 本身为本地部署工具,不提供SaaS账号或中心化控制台,其“插件开发documentation”并非单一官方产品,而是由以下三类资源构成:
- Step 1:确认版本来源:区分 GitHub 官方仓库(
openclaw-org/openclaw,MIT协议,含基础SDK与CLI)、第三方商业增强版(如部分服务商提供的带GUI/云调度的闭源分支); - Step 2:获取核心文档:官方仅维护
docs/目录下的 Markdown 文件(含插件生命周期、Hook 规范、Context API、TypeScript 类型定义); - Step 3:搭建开发环境:Node.js ≥18 + TypeScript + Playwright(需自行安装 Chromium);
- Step 4:创建插件模板:运行
npx openclaw-cli create-plugin(若 CLI 已发布)或手动按plugin-manifest.json + index.ts结构组织; - Step 5:本地调试:使用
openclaw run --plugin ./my-plugin加载并测试; - Step 6:部署与分发:插件以 npm 包形式发布,或直接复制至 OpenClaw
plugins/目录下启用(无中心审核机制)。
⚠️ 注意:截至2024年Q2,OpenClaw 无官方插件市场,所有文档均来自 GitHub 仓库及社区 Wiki(如 GitHub Discussions、Discord #dev-channel)。所谓“全网最全”,实为开发者自发整理的文档聚合索引(如 openclaw-community/docs),非官方出品。
费用/成本通常受哪些因素影响
- 是否采用商业增强版(含云调度、反检测服务、技术支持);
- 插件复杂度(是否需集成OCR、代理池、验证码识别模块);
- 部署方式(本地服务器 vs Docker集群 vs 无服务器函数);
- 团队技术能力(是否需外包开发或内部投入前端/Node.js工程师);
- 目标平台反爬强度(如Amazon、Temu对自动化流量管控升级,倒逼插件增加指纹伪造、时序扰动等成本)。
为了拿到准确报价/成本,你通常需要准备:目标平台清单、采集字段列表、并发量要求、SLA响应时效、是否需长期维护支持。
常见坑与避坑清单
- 避坑1:误将社区教程当官方文档——OpenClaw 官方 repo 文档极简,大量“最佳实践”来自 Discord 成员分享,务必交叉验证代码片段有效性;
- 避坑2:忽略平台 robots.txt 与 ToS 风险——即使技术可行,高频采集 Amazon 商品页可能触发账户关联或法律警告,需自行评估合规边界;
- 避坑3:未处理动态渲染依赖(如React懒加载、GraphQL请求)——仅靠 DOM 解析易漏数据,必须结合 Network 拦截或 GraphQL 查询注入;
- 避坑4:插件热更新失败却无日志——建议强制在
index.ts中添加console.log('loaded')及 try-catch 全局错误捕获,避免静默失效。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w 是 MIT 协议开源项目,代码透明、可审计;但插件开发行为本身不自带合规性。是否合规取决于你用插件做什么、采集哪些数据、是否获得平台授权。例如:采集公开商品标题/价格属合理使用范畴;批量下载用户评论ID用于群发营销则可能违反平台ToS。合规责任完全由使用者承担。
{关键词} 适合哪些卖家/平台/地区/类目?
适合具备基础前端/Node.js能力的中大型跨境团队、ERP厂商、独立站SAAS服务商;主要适配 Shopee、Lazada、Amazon(非SP-API路径)、AliExpress、独立站(Shopify/WooCommerce) 等前端渲染为主的平台;对高动态交互类目(如服饰尺码表、变体JS加载)支持较好,但对强风控平台(如Temu后台管理页)需额外投入反检测开发。
{关键词} 怎么开通/注册/接入/购买?需要哪些资料?
OpenClaw 无需注册、不开通、不售卖——它是开源工具,直接克隆 GitHub 仓库即可使用。所谓“documentation”是静态文档,不存在“购买”环节。你需要的是:Git 客户端、Node.js 环境、目标平台账号(仅用于登录验证,非API密钥)。商业增强版若有销售,需联系对应服务商签约,合同条款以对方为准。
结尾
“全网最全OpenClaw(龙虾)插件开发documentation”本质是开发者共建的知识沉淀,非标准化交付物。

